I have a 2005 convertible Mini Cooper. I recently disconnected the battery and several things stopped working after reconnecting it. The convertible top, A/C, and a couple interior lights are most notable. Does anyone have any suggestions as to why this would happen?

The roof is because the car doesn't know where the windows are the roof button will flash red when pressed . lower the windows and raise all them again. it should reset.
